CVE-2015-4515Date: (C)2015-12-15   (M)2024-03-27


Mozilla Firefox before 42.0, when NTLM v1 is enabled for HTTP authentication, all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ive hostname information by constructing a crafted web site that sends an NTLM request and reads the Workstation field of an NTLM type 3 message.

CVSS Score and Metrics +CVSS Score and Metrics -

CVSS V2 Severity:
CVSS Score : 4.3
Exploit Score: 8.6
Impact Score: 2.9
 
CVSS V2 Metrics:
Access Vector: NETWORK
Access Complexity: MEDIUM
Authentication: NONE
Confidentiality: PARTIAL
Integrity: NONE
Availability: NONE
